"Place me on Sunium's marbled steep, Where nothing, save the waves and I, May hear our mutual murmurs sweep; There, swan-like, let me sing and die: A land of slaves shall ne'er be mine- Dash down yon cup of Samian wine!"

... wrote Lord Byron in the 19th century, who visited the Temple of Poseidon at Sounion and carved his name on one of the pillars. The temple has an impressive position giving views, on a clear day, to Kea and Kythnos, Aegina and the Peloponnese. What's more, it forms a perfect triangle with the Parthenon in Athens and the Temple of Aphaia on Aegina. On this tour you can enjoy 'Sunium's marbled steep'.

Upon arrival at Cape Sounion, you'll visit the 5th century B.C. Temple of Poseidon with its magnificent panoramic views of the Aegean Sea. On a clear day you can see seven islands! Cape Sounion has long played an important part in Greek mythology and history, and the first recorded mention of it occurs in the Odyssey, as the last safe landing before Poseidon scattered the returning Greek navy. As god of the sea, Poseidon was important to ancient Greeks, and the scale of the Temple at Cape Sounion reflects that.
